Protecting Your Flock: The Importance Of Biosecurity In Poultry

Biosecurity is a term that has gained significant attention in recent years, especially within the poultry industry. The concept of biosecurity refers to practices and measures put in place to prevent the introduction and spread of disease within a population of animals. In the case of poultry, maintaining high levels of biosecurity is crucial to protecting the health and well-being of the flock.

Poultry are particularly susceptible to diseases due to their dense populations, rapid growth rate, and intensive production systems. Avian influenza, Newcastle disease, and infectious bronchitis are just a few examples of highly contagious and potentially devastating diseases that can decimate a poultry flock. This makes biosecurity a top priority for poultry producers, regardless of the size of their operation.

There are several key components to effective biosecurity in poultry. The first and most important step is to control access to the farm. This includes limiting the number of people and vehicles that come onto the property, as well as ensuring that all visitors are aware of and adhere to biosecurity protocols. This can be achieved by implementing strict visitor policies, providing designated parking areas away from the barns, and requiring all visitors to wear clean clothing and footwear or use disposable coveralls and boots while on the premises.

Another critical aspect of biosecurity is maintaining a clean and sanitary environment within the poultry housing facilities. Regular cleaning and disinfection of barns, equipment, and feeders are essential to prevent the accumulation and spread of pathogens. It is also important to carefully manage the manure and dead bird disposal to minimize the risk of disease transmission. Additionally, keeping wild birds and rodents away from the poultry facilities can help prevent the introduction of pathogens from outside sources.

Proper hygiene practices are also crucial in maintaining biosecurity. Poultry producers and workers should wash their hands thoroughly before and after handling birds or eggs, as well as wear clean clothing and boots each time they enter the barn. Equipment should be regularly cleaned and disinfected between uses to prevent cross-contamination. All personnel should be educated on the importance of biosecurity and be trained in proper hygiene practices to reduce the risk of disease spread.

Implementing a robust vaccination program is another important component of biosecurity in poultry. Vaccines can help protect the flock from a variety of diseases and reduce the likelihood of outbreaks. It is essential to work with a veterinarian to develop a vaccination schedule that is tailored to the specific needs of the flock and the risks present in the region. Regularly monitoring the health of the birds and conducting diagnostic testing when necessary can help identify and address potential health issues before they escalate.

Biosecurity is not only essential for protecting the health and well-being of the flock but also for safeguarding the financial viability of the operation. Disease outbreaks can result in significant losses due to increased mortality, reduced growth rates, decreased egg production, and the need for costly treatments. In some cases, entire flocks may need to be culled to prevent the spread of disease, leading to even greater economic losses. By investing in biosecurity measures upfront, producers can mitigate the risk of disease outbreaks and minimize the impact on their bottom line.
